Koding features and specs

  • Integrated Development Environment (IDE)
    Koding offers an integrated development environment that supports multiple programming languages, which streamlines the development process by providing tools and features in one platform.
  • Cloud-based
    Being a cloud-based platform, Koding allows you to work on your projects from anywhere with an internet connection, fostering better collaboration and convenience.
  • Pre-configured Environments
    Koding provides pre-configured development environments for various technologies, allowing users to bypass lengthy setup processes and start coding immediately.
  • Collaboration Features
    The platform includes collaboration tools such as shared terminals and real-time code collaboration, which are useful for team projects and pair programming.
  • Scalability
    Koding's infrastructure can scale according to the needs of the user, making it suitable for both individual developers and larger development teams.

Possible disadvantages of Koding

  • Pricing
    While Koding offers a free tier, more advanced features and greater resources typically require a paid subscription, which might not be affordable for all users.
  • Performance
    Some users have reported performance issues, especially when working with more resource-intensive projects, as cloud environments can occasionally be slower compared to local machines.
  • Learning Curve
    Although it is feature-rich, the platform can be intimidating for beginners due to its complex interface and extensive toolset.
  • Dependency on Internet
    As a cloud-based platform, Koding requires a stable internet connection for optimal performance, which might be a limitation in areas with poor connectivity.
  • Limited Customization
    Users might find the pre-configured environments limiting if they have specific customization requirements that are not supported out of the box.

PyLint features and specs

  • Extensive Error Checking
    PyLint provides comprehensive checks for errors in Python code, including syntax errors, structural problems, and more complex issues like unused variables and undefined names.
  • Customizability
    PyLint allows users to configure which types of errors and warnings they want to check for through configuration files, making it adaptable to different coding standards and preferences.
  • Integration with Development Tools
    PyLint can be integrated with various IDEs and editors such as Visual Studio Code, PyCharm, and more, enhancing the development workflow by providing real-time feedback.
  • Code Quality Metrics
    It offers additional metrics and ratings for code quality, helping developers understand the complexity and maintainability of their code.
  • Code Refactoring Support
    PyLint suggests specific code improvements and refactorings, which can enhance the readability and performance of the code.

Possible disadvantages of PyLint

  • Performance Overhead
    Analyzing large codebases can be slow with PyLint, impacting performance and increasing the time taken for continuous integration pipelines to run.
  • False Positives
    PyLint can generate false positive warnings, particularly in complex or dynamically-typed code, which might lead to developers spending time investigating non-issues.
  • Steep Learning Curve
    The initial setup and configuration of PyLint can be challenging for new users who are not familiar with its extensive customization options.
  • Strictness
    PyLint is very strict by default, which might overwhelm developers, especially those working in less formal or rapid development environments, with a high volume of warnings and errors.
  • Compatibility Issues
    There might be compatibility issues with certain Python versions or specific coding patterns, leading to inaccurate linting results or the need for frequent adjustments to configurations.

Analysis of PyLint

Overall verdict

  • PyLint is generally considered a good tool for Python developers, especially those who want to maintain high code quality. While some users may find it overly strict at times, its comprehensive analysis is beneficial for identifying both significant errors and minor code improvements. Its configurability allows users to tailor its checks according to their project's specific needs.

Why this product is good

  • PyLint is a widely used static code analysis tool for Python that helps ensure code quality and adherence to coding standards. It analyzes Python source code to look for programming errors, enforce a coding standard, and suggest code improvements. It provides detailed insights into potential issues and helps maintain consistency and readability in Python projects.
